Subject: [PATCH v6 2/2] drm/msm/dp: enhance dp controller isr
Date: Tue, 27 Dec 2022 18:16:25 -0800	[thread overview]
Message-ID: <1672193785-11003-3-git-send-email-quic_khsieh@quicinc.com> (raw)
In-Reply-To: <1672193785-11003-1-git-send-email-quic_khsieh@quicinc.com>

dp_display_irq_handler() is the main isr handler with the helps
of two sub isr, dp_aux_isr and dp_ctrl_isr, to service all DP
interrupts on every irq triggered. Current all three isr does
not return IRQ_HANDLED if there are any interrupts it had
serviced. This patch fix this ambiguity by having all isr
return IRQ_HANDLED if there are interrupts had been serviced
or IRQ_NONE otherwise.

diff --git a/drivers/gpu/drm/msm/dp/dp_aux.c b/drivers/gpu/drm/msm/dp/dp_aux.c
index cc3efed..d01ff45 100644
--- a/drivers/gpu/drm/msm/dp/dp_aux.c
+++ b/drivers/gpu/drm/msm/dp/dp_aux.c
@@ -162,45 +162,84 @@ static ssize_t dp_aux_cmd_fifo_rx(struct dp_aux_private *aux,
 	return i;
 }
 
-static void dp_aux_native_handler(struct dp_aux_private *aux, u32 isr)
+static irqreturn_t dp_aux_native_handler(struct dp_aux_private *aux, u32 isr)
 {
-	if (isr & DP_INTR_AUX_I2C_DONE)
+	irqreturn_t ret = IRQ_NONE;
+
+	if (isr & DP_INTR_AUX_I2C_DONE) {
 		aux->aux_error_num = DP_AUX_ERR_NONE;
-	else if (isr & DP_INTR_WRONG_ADDR)
+		ret = IRQ_HANDLED;
+	} else if (isr & DP_INTR_WRONG_ADDR) {
 		aux->aux_error_num = DP_AUX_ERR_ADDR;
-	else if (isr & DP_INTR_TIMEOUT)
+		ret = IRQ_HANDLED;
+	} else if (isr & DP_INTR_TIMEOUT) {
 		aux->aux_error_num = DP_AUX_ERR_TOUT;
-	if (isr & DP_INTR_NACK_DEFER)
+		ret = IRQ_HANDLED;
+	}
+
+	if (isr & DP_INTR_NACK_DEFER) {
 		aux->aux_error_num = DP_AUX_ERR_NACK;
+		ret = IRQ_HANDLED;
+	}
+
 	if (isr & DP_INTR_AUX_ERROR) {
 		aux->aux_error_num = DP_AUX_ERR_PHY;
 		dp_catalog_aux_clear_hw_interrupts(aux->catalog);
+		ret = IRQ_HANDLED;
 	}
+
+	if (ret == IRQ_HANDLED)
+		complete(&aux->comp);
+
+	return ret;
 }
 
-static void dp_aux_i2c_handler(struct dp_aux_private *aux, u32 isr)
+static irqreturn_t dp_aux_i2c_handler(struct dp_aux_private *aux, u32 isr)
 {
+	irqreturn_t ret = IRQ_NONE;
+
 	if (isr & DP_INTR_AUX_I2C_DONE) {
 		if (isr & (DP_INTR_I2C_NACK | DP_INTR_I2C_DEFER))
 			aux->aux_error_num = DP_AUX_ERR_NACK;
 		else
 			aux->aux_error_num = DP_AUX_ERR_NONE;
-	} else {
-		if (isr & DP_INTR_WRONG_ADDR)
-			aux->aux_error_num = DP_AUX_ERR_ADDR;
-		else if (isr & DP_INTR_TIMEOUT)
-			aux->aux_error_num = DP_AUX_ERR_TOUT;
-		if (isr & DP_INTR_NACK_DEFER)
-			aux->aux_error_num = DP_AUX_ERR_NACK_DEFER;
-		if (isr & DP_INTR_I2C_NACK)
-			aux->aux_error_num = DP_AUX_ERR_NACK;
-		if (isr & DP_INTR_I2C_DEFER)
-			aux->aux_error_num = DP_AUX_ERR_DEFER;
-		if (isr & DP_INTR_AUX_ERROR) {
-			aux->aux_error_num = DP_AUX_ERR_PHY;
-			dp_catalog_aux_clear_hw_interrupts(aux->catalog);
-		}
+
+		return IRQ_HANDLED;
 	}
+
+	if (isr & DP_INTR_WRONG_ADDR) {
+		aux->aux_error_num = DP_AUX_ERR_ADDR;
+		ret = IRQ_HANDLED;
+	} else if (isr & DP_INTR_TIMEOUT) {
+		aux->aux_error_num = DP_AUX_ERR_TOUT;
+		ret = IRQ_HANDLED;
+	}
+
+	if (isr & DP_INTR_NACK_DEFER) {
+		aux->aux_error_num = DP_AUX_ERR_NACK_DEFER;
+		ret = IRQ_HANDLED;
+	}
+
+	if (isr & DP_INTR_I2C_NACK) {
+		aux->aux_error_num = DP_AUX_ERR_NACK;
+		ret = IRQ_HANDLED;
+	}
+
+	if (isr & DP_INTR_I2C_DEFER) {
+		aux->aux_error_num = DP_AUX_ERR_DEFER;
+		ret = IRQ_HANDLED;
+	}
+
+	if (isr & DP_INTR_AUX_ERROR) {
+		aux->aux_error_num = DP_AUX_ERR_PHY;
+		dp_catalog_aux_clear_hw_interrupts(aux->catalog);
+		ret = IRQ_HANDLED;
+	}
+
+	if (ret == IRQ_HANDLED)
+		complete(&aux->comp);
+
+	return ret;
 }
 
 static void dp_aux_update_offset_and_segment(struct dp_aux_private *aux,
@@ -409,14 +448,14 @@ static ssize_t dp_aux_transfer(struct drm_dp_aux *dp_aux,
 	return ret;
 }
 
-void dp_aux_isr(struct drm_dp_aux *dp_aux)
+irqreturn_t dp_aux_isr(struct drm_dp_aux *dp_aux)
 {
 	u32 isr;
 	struct dp_aux_private *aux;
 
 	if (!dp_aux) {
 		DRM_ERROR("invalid input\n");
-		return;
+		return IRQ_NONE;
 	}
 
 	aux = container_of(dp_aux, struct dp_aux_private, dp_aux);
@@ -425,17 +464,15 @@ void dp_aux_isr(struct drm_dp_aux *dp_aux)
 
 	/* no interrupts pending, return immediately */
 	if (!isr)
-		return;
+		return IRQ_NONE;
 
 	if (!aux->cmd_busy)
-		return;
+		return IRQ_NONE;
 
 	if (aux->native)
-		dp_aux_native_handler(aux, isr);
+		return dp_aux_native_handler(aux, isr);
 	else
-		dp_aux_i2c_handler(aux, isr);
-
-	complete(&aux->comp);
+		return dp_aux_i2c_handler(aux, isr);
 }
 
 void dp_aux_reconfig(struct drm_dp_aux *dp_aux)
diff --git a/drivers/gpu/drm/msm/dp/dp_aux.h b/drivers/gpu/drm/msm/dp/dp_aux.h
index e930974..511305d 100644
--- a/drivers/gpu/drm/msm/dp/dp_aux.h
+++ b/drivers/gpu/drm/msm/dp/dp_aux.h
@@ -11,7 +11,7 @@
 
 int dp_aux_register(struct drm_dp_aux *dp_aux);
 void dp_aux_unregister(struct drm_dp_aux *dp_aux);
-void dp_aux_isr(struct drm_dp_aux *dp_aux);
+irqreturn_t dp_aux_isr(struct drm_dp_aux *dp_aux);
 void dp_aux_init(struct drm_dp_aux *dp_aux);
 void dp_aux_deinit(struct drm_dp_aux *dp_aux);
 void dp_aux_reconfig(struct drm_dp_aux *dp_aux);
diff --git a/drivers/gpu/drm/msm/dp/dp_ctrl.c b/drivers/gpu/drm/msm/dp/dp_ctrl.c
index 3854c9f..cb0acb1 100644
--- a/drivers/gpu/drm/msm/dp/dp_ctrl.c
+++ b/drivers/gpu/drm/msm/dp/dp_ctrl.c
@@ -1982,27 +1982,35 @@ int dp_ctrl_off(struct dp_ctrl *dp_ctrl)
 	return ret;
 }
 
-void dp_ctrl_isr(struct dp_ctrl *dp_ctrl)
+irqreturn_t dp_ctrl_isr(struct dp_ctrl *dp_ctrl)
 {
 	struct dp_ctrl_private *ctrl;
 	u32 isr;
+	irqreturn_t ret = IRQ_NONE;
 
 	if (!dp_ctrl)
-		return;
+		return IRQ_NONE;
 
 	ctrl = container_of(dp_ctrl, struct dp_ctrl_private, dp_ctrl);
 
 	isr = dp_catalog_ctrl_get_interrupt(ctrl->catalog);
+	/* no interrupts pending, return immediately */
+	if (!isr)
+		return IRQ_NONE;
 
 	if (isr & DP_CTRL_INTR_READY_FOR_VIDEO) {
 		drm_dbg_dp(ctrl->drm_dev, "dp_video_ready\n");
 		complete(&ctrl->video_comp);
+		ret = IRQ_HANDLED;
 	}
 
 	if (isr & DP_CTRL_INTR_IDLE_PATTERN_SENT) {
 		drm_dbg_dp(ctrl->drm_dev, "idle_patterns_sent\n");
 		complete(&ctrl->idle_comp);
+		ret = IRQ_HANDLED;
 	}
+
+	return ret;
 }
 
 struct dp_ctrl *dp_ctrl_get(struct device *dev, struct dp_link *link,
diff --git a/drivers/gpu/drm/msm/dp/dp_ctrl.h b/drivers/gpu/drm/msm/dp/dp_ctrl.h
index 9f29734..c3af06d 100644
--- a/drivers/gpu/drm/msm/dp/dp_ctrl.h
+++ b/drivers/gpu/drm/msm/dp/dp_ctrl.h
@@ -25,7 +25,7 @@ int dp_ctrl_off_link_stream(struct dp_ctrl *dp_ctrl);
 int dp_ctrl_off_link(struct dp_ctrl *dp_ctrl);
 int dp_ctrl_off(struct dp_ctrl *dp_ctrl);
 void dp_ctrl_push_idle(struct dp_ctrl *dp_ctrl);
-void dp_ctrl_isr(struct dp_ctrl *dp_ctrl);
+irqreturn_t dp_ctrl_isr(struct dp_ctrl *dp_ctrl);
 void dp_ctrl_handle_sink_request(struct dp_ctrl *dp_ctrl);
 struct dp_ctrl *dp_ctrl_get(struct device *dev, struct dp_link *link,
 			struct dp_panel *panel,	struct drm_dp_aux *aux,
diff --git a/drivers/gpu/drm/msm/dp/dp_display.c b/drivers/gpu/drm/msm/dp/dp_display.c
index bfd0aef..d40bfbd 100644
--- a/drivers/gpu/drm/msm/dp/dp_display.c
+++ b/drivers/gpu/drm/msm/dp/dp_display.c
@@ -1192,7 +1192,7 @@ static int dp_hpd_event_thread_start(struct dp_display_private *dp_priv)
 static irqreturn_t dp_display_irq_handler(int irq, void *dev_id)
 {
 	struct dp_display_private *dp = dev_id;
-	irqreturn_t ret = IRQ_HANDLED;
+	irqreturn_t ret = IRQ_NONE;
 	u32 hpd_isr_status;
 
 	if (!dp) {
@@ -1206,27 +1206,33 @@ static irqreturn_t dp_display_irq_handler(int irq, void *dev_id)
 		drm_dbg_dp(dp->drm_dev, "type=%d isr=0x%x\n",
 			dp->dp_display.connector_type, hpd_isr_status);
 		/* hpd related interrupts */
-		if (hpd_isr_status & DP_DP_HPD_PLUG_INT_MASK)
+		if (hpd_isr_status & DP_DP_HPD_PLUG_INT_MASK) {
 			dp_add_event(dp, EV_HPD_PLUG_INT, 0, 0);
+			ret = IRQ_HANDLED;
+		}
 
 		if (hpd_isr_status & DP_DP_IRQ_HPD_INT_MASK) {
 			dp_add_event(dp, EV_IRQ_HPD_INT, 0, 0);
+			ret = IRQ_HANDLED;
 		}
 
 		if (hpd_isr_status & DP_DP_HPD_REPLUG_INT_MASK) {
 			dp_add_event(dp, EV_HPD_UNPLUG_INT, 0, 0);
 			dp_add_event(dp, EV_HPD_PLUG_INT, 0, 3);
+			ret = IRQ_HANDLED;
 		}
 
-		if (hpd_isr_status & DP_DP_HPD_UNPLUG_INT_MASK)
+		if (hpd_isr_status & DP_DP_HPD_UNPLUG_INT_MASK) {
 			dp_add_event(dp, EV_HPD_UNPLUG_INT, 0, 0);
+			ret = IRQ_HANDLED;
+		}
 	}
 
 	/* DP controller isr */
-	dp_ctrl_isr(dp->ctrl);
+	ret |= dp_ctrl_isr(dp->ctrl);
 
 	/* DP aux isr */
-	dp_aux_isr(dp->aux);
+	ret |= dp_aux_isr(dp->aux);
 
 	return ret;
 }
